Quoting: Tangy That will be at the depth where olivine spontaneously transitions to spinel due to pressure; the earthquakes are due to the volume change. There's an even deeper zone where spinel turns to perovskite (around 600-700 km), but the subducted slab has usually turned ductile before that happens, so I believe you only get those rarely, in very high-speed subduction zones... but I'm getting rusty on this, now.
